1. Why Tangerine Oil Is Ideal for Relaxation
Tangerine oil, derived from the peel of the citrus fruit, has become a favorite among essential oils for relaxation. Its sweet, uplifting aroma carries a natural ability to soothe the mind and ease tension. Unlike heavier or more medicinal scents, tangerine oil offers a bright and refreshing fragrance that can transform stressful environments into calm sanctuaries.
This oil’s gentle nature makes it particularly suitable for those new to aromatherapy or sensitive to strong fragrances. Its widespread appeal is not only because of the pleasant scent but also due to its reputation as a mood booster and anxiety reliever, making it an excellent choice for daily relaxation rituals.
2. Chemical Properties and Aroma Impact on Mood
The therapeutic effects of tangerine oil come from its rich content of limonene, a natural compound found in citrus oils. Limonene is well-known for its anti-anxiety and mood-enhancing properties. When inhaled, tangerine oil stimulates the limbic system—the part of the brain responsible for emotions and memories—helping to reduce feelings of stress and promote a sense of happiness.
Besides limonene, tangerine oil contains myrcene and pinene, compounds linked with relaxation and pain relief. This complex chemical makeup is what differentiates tangerine oil from other citrus oils and enhances its calming effect, making it highly effective for emotional well-being.
3. Effective Ways to Use Tangerine Oil for Relaxation
Incorporating tangerine oil into your relaxation routine can be simple and enjoyable. Diffusing a few drops in your living space or bedroom can instantly uplift the atmosphere, easing tension after a long day. Many people also mix tangerine oil with carrier oils such as jojoba or almond oil for gentle massage applications, which promotes muscle relaxation alongside mental calm.
Adding tangerine oil to bath water creates a soothing soak that relaxes both body and mind. Additionally, blending it with other essential oils like lavender or chamomile can enhance its calming properties, creating personalized aromatic blends tailored to your preferences.
For beginners, starting with small amounts and observing how your body reacts is advisable to avoid skin irritation. Regular use can build a positive association with relaxation, encouraging deeper rest and reduced anxiety over time.
4. Scientific Evidence Supporting Relaxation Benefits
Multiple studies have supported the use of tangerine oil for relaxation and stress reduction. Research published in journals of complementary medicine has shown that inhalation of citrus oils including tangerine reduces cortisol levels—a hormone associated with stress—and improves mood scores in study participants.
Clinical trials have further demonstrated that tangerine oil can decrease anxiety symptoms in various populations, from students facing exams to patients in clinical settings. While more research is ongoing, the current scientific consensus underscores the oil’s effectiveness as a natural aid for relaxation.
These findings provide credibility to anecdotal experiences and suggest that tangerine oil is more than just a pleasant scent—it has measurable physiological effects beneficial for mental health.

6. Choosing Quality Tangerine Oil Products
Not all tangerine oils on the market are created equal. To experience true relaxation benefits, it’s crucial to choose high-quality, pure essential oils. Look for products labeled as 100% pure, cold-pressed, and sourced from reputable growers.
Beware of synthetic fragrances or diluted oils that lack therapeutic properties. Reading customer reviews and checking for third-party testing can help identify trustworthy brands. Using quality oils ensures safety, effectiveness, and a more enjoyable aromatic experience.
